Ansicht
Dokumentation

Business- und Interface-Objekte und BAPI-Methoden (geändert) ( RELNSCM500_APO_INT_BAPI )

Business- und Interface-Objekte und BAPI-Methoden (geändert) ( RELNSCM500_APO_INT_BAPI )

PERFORM Short Reference   RFUMSV00 - Advance Return for Tax on Sales/Purchases  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Kurztext

Business- und Interface-Objekte und BAPI-Methoden (geändert)

Verwendung

Die folgenden Informationen beschreiben Änderungen, die in SAP SCM 5.0 an Business- und Interface-Objekten und den darin enthaltenden Business Application Programming Interfaces (BAPIs) bzw. ALE-Schnittstellen (Nachrichtentypen) aus folgenden Komponenten vorgenommen wurden:

  • SCM-APO-MD,,Stammdaten
  • SCM-APO-SNP,,Supply Network Planning (SNP)
  • SCM-APO-PPS,,Produktion- und Feinplanung
  • SCM-APO-VS,,Vehicle Scheduling
  • SCM-APO-FCS,,Absatzplanung

Die technischen Namen der betroffenen Objekte im Business Object Repository (BOR) sind:

  • BUS10502
  • BUS10503
  • BUS10300
  • BUS10500
  • BUS10001 - BUS10002
  • BUS 10014
  • BUS11201
  • BUS10009
  • BUS10015
  • BUS10017
  • Transaktion /SAPAPO/BP3
  • BUS10030

Die zugehörigen Interface-Objekte, falls vorhanden, haben die gleichen Nummern, z.B. gehört zum Business-Objekt BUS10502 das Interface-Objekt IF10502.

Verwendung der IDOCs/ALE-Schnittstellen sowie der Funktionsbausteine der BAPI-Methoden

Änderungen an den BAPI-Methoden wirken sich auch auf die jeweils zugehörigen ALE-Schnittstellen bzw. Nachrichtentypen aus. Wenn Sie IDOC-Nachrichtentypen verwenden, die die zugehörigen BAPI-Methoden dieser Business-Objekte aufrufen, lesen Sie die Release-Informationen der zugehörigen BAPI-Methoden.

Beispiel

Sie verwenden den Nachrichtentyp SOAPS_SAVEMULTIPLE. Da diese aus dem BAPI BUS10501.Save.Multiple (Kundenauftrag APS) abgeleitet ist, wirken sich die Änderungen an BUS10501.SaveMultiple ebenso auf den Nachrichtentyp SOAPS_SAVEMULTIPLE aus.

Ebenso wirken sich Änderungen an den BAPI-Methoden auch auf die zugrunde liegenden Funktionsbausteine aus. Z.B. eine Änderung an der Methode "SalesOrderAPS.SaveMultiple" wirkt sich ebenso auf den verwendeten Funktionsbaustein BAPI_SLSRVAPS_SAVEMULTI aus.

Änderungen, die nur Methoden bestimmter Business-Objekte / Interface-Objekte dieser Komponenten bzw. deren Methoden und ALE-Nachrichtentypen betreffen

Es erfolgt eine Auflistung der neuen und geänderten Business-Objekten und BAPIs. Genauere Informationen finden Sie in der Dokumentation der einzelnen BAPIs.

Beachten Sie, dass manche der aufgeführten BAPIs noch nicht freigegeben sind. Diese BAPIs können Sie zwar schon verwenden, jedoch sind noch inkompatible Änderungen möglich.

Wenn Sie statt der BAPIs die zugehörigen Funktionsbausteine der BAPIs verwenden, gelten die Änderungen auch für diese Funktionsbausteine.

Bewegungsdatenobjekte

BUS10502 (Beschaffungsauftrag APS)

Mit der neuen Methode CreateFromSNP können Sie Bestellanforderungen für Supply Network Planning (SNP) oder Deployment anlegen oder ändern. Bei der Methode SaveMultiple2 wurde das Feld für Transportmittel hinzugefügt. Die Methode wurde um die Steuerung der Ereigniserzeugung erweitert. Die Methode DeleteMultiple wurde um die Steuerung der Ereigniserzeugung erweitert.

IF10502 (Interface-Objekt für Beschaffungsauftrag APS)

BUS10503 (Produktionsauftrag APS)

Die Methode CreateFromTemplatewurde um PDS-Funktionalität erweitert. Die Methode CreateFromSNP wurde um das Profil der globalen SNP-Einstellungen erweitert.

IF10503 (Interface-Objekt für Produktionsauftrag APS)

BUS10300 (Vehicle Scheduling Planning Services)

Die Methoden GetOrderSets, UnplanOrders und UpdateShipments wurden um die Funktion Auftragssplit erweitert.

BUS10500 (PPDSServiceAPS)

Mit der neuen Methode ExecutePlanningRunkönnen Sie in der Produktions- und Feinplanung (PP/DS) einen Planungslauf starten.

Stammdatenobjekte

BUS10001 (Produkt APS)

Kompatible Erweiterung (neue Felder) in den Methoden SaveMultiple2, GetList2und RequestList2

IF10001 (Interface-Objekt für Produkt APS)

Kompatible Erweiterung (neue Felder) in der Methode ReceiveList2.

BUS10002 (Lokation APS)

Kompatible Erweiterung (neue Felder) in den Methoden SaveMultiple2, GetList2und RequestList2.

IF10002 (Interface-Objekt für Lokation APS)

Kompatible Erweiterung (neue Felder) in der Methode ReceiveList2.

BUS10014 (Produktionsdatenstruktur APS)

Neue Methoden: SaveMultiple, DeleteMultiple, GetListund RequestList.

IF10014 (Interface-Objekt für Produkionsdatenstruktur APS)

Neue Methode ReceiveList.

BUS11201 (Transportbeziehung APS)

Kompatible Erweiterung (neue Felder) in den Methoden SaveMultiple2, GetList2und RequestList2.

IF11201 (Interface-Objekt für Transportbeziehung APS)

Kompatible Erweiterung (neue Felder) in der Methode ReceiveList2.

BUS10009 (Quotierung APS)

Kompatible Erweiterung (neue Felder) in den Methoden SaveMultiple2, GetList2und RequestList2.

IF10009 (Interface-Objekt für Quotierung APS)

Kompatible Erweiterung (neue Felder) in der Methode ReceiveList2.

BUS10015 (Lokationsprodukthierarchie APS)

Neue Methoden: GetDetail, SaveNodes, RemoveNodesund RequestDetail.

IF10015 (Interface-Objekt für Lokationsprodukthierarchie APS)

Neue Methode ReceiveNodes.

BUS10017 (Produkthierarchie APS)

Neue Methoden: GetDetail, SaveNodes, RemoveNodesund RequestDetail.

IF10017 (Interface-Objekt für Produkthierarchie APS)

Neue Methode ReceiveNodes.

Transaktion "/SAPAPO/BP3"

Neue Transaktion zur Versendung von Stammdaten an externe Systeme.

Objekte der Absatzplanung

BUS10030 (Planungsmappe APS)

Den Methoden GetDetail2und ChangeKeyFigureValue2wurden die Funktionen Fixierung von Kennzahlen und Unterscheidung von Null-und Initialwert hinzugefügt.

Auswirkungen auf den Datenbestand

Auswirkungen auf die Datenübernahme

Auswirkungen auf die Systemverwaltung

Auswirkungen auf das Customizing

Weitere Informationen






CPI1466 during Backup   Fill RESBD Structure from EBP Component Structure  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 8980 Date: 20240523 Time: 194905     sap01-206 ( 101 ms )